Chelsea manager Mauricio Pochettino has confirmed that Wesley Fofana is likely to miss the rest of the season.

The centre-back has not played this campaign after sustaining an ACL injury back in the summer and, asked for the latest on Fofana’s fitness, Pochettino said:

“Unfortunately, I think it is difficult to see him [again this season].”

Last month, the Frenchman took to X with a positive update on his fitness, suggesting he would be back soon.

However, it appears that Fofana’s recovery has not been as straightforward as expected and it looks like he will now miss the entire season.

Fofana’s injury record since joining Chelsea

The 23-year-old has spent 355 days on the sidelines after moving to Chelsea in the summer of 2022; that’s almost an entire calendar year.

What should concern fans even more is that the three injuries he has sustained have all been knee problems. It, therefore, remains to be seen whether Fofana can return to his best once he recovers full fitness.
